Godstone sinkholes: Major incident declared in Surrey as second crater opens up in street

  • Residents of Godstone, Surrey have been evacuated after a sinkhole opened on February 17, reaching at least 65 feet deep.
  • Surrey County Council declared a major incident as experts work to ensure safety.
  • SES Water confirmed a burst water main may have caused the sinkhole.
  • Local authorities are supporting affected residents with emergency accommodations and services in place.
